A small business website can measure success in numerous ways, but probably the most common is traffic. Everyone wants traffic. The more traffic you have the better, correct? I disagree. I would rather get 100 visitors to my site that are strongly interested in my services vs. getting 1000 visitors that really do not care. [...] [...more]

Just what is Public Relations? The simplest answer is this:
Communications that help a person or business enhance and protect their reputation. PR can be something as simple as having a client or colleague talk you up in a business or social setting. For many companies, PR is a vital function that goes hand-in-hand with marketing [...] [...more]
